<p>The winery’s small but passionate group works to protect the ecological balance of the region, and their Isolation Ridge winery is certified organic. The Great Southern made its name in apples and wool for many years, but in the Fifties these industries slowed down. This wild and distant area could have appeared an unlikely house of nice wine to some, however authorities viticulturist Bill Jamieson knew the realm had grape-growing promise. The Western Australian Government invited Professor Harold Olmo, a prestigious viticulturist from California, to return and investigate. He declared that the region can be good for producing premium wines, and a couple of decade later, in 1964, the Government planted an experimental winery at Forest Hill.</p>

The Great Southern wine area is situated in the Great Southern area of Western Australia. It is Australia&#8217;s largest wine space, stretching 200 kilometres (120 miles) east to west and more than one hundred kilometres (62 miles) north to south.</p>

<p>Albany and the encompassing area are residence to a few of Western Australia’s most famous and awarded wineries, boasting high quality wines and sophisticated flavours in each red and white varieties. The Lower Kalgan area is considered one of the state’s earliest farming districts. In 1829, naval surgeon and explorer Thomas Braidwood Wilson remarked that the land alongside the Kalgan River was suitable for cultivation and properly adapted to the expansion of the vine.
